Preloaded Coated Filters
Cat. No. 225-9019
SKC coated lters are shipped preloaded in casse es with end plugs and shrink
bands in place. No assembly is required; they are ready to use.
Method & Chemical: OSHA 81 for crotonaldehyde
Filter & Coating: 2 glass ber lters treated with 2,4-dinitrophenylhydrazine and
phosphoric acid. Three-piece 37-mm casse e. Open-face sampling con guration
Prior to Sampling: Store at 39.2 F (4 C) for up to 3 months.
Sample Stability: Store samples in the dark at -4 F (-20 C). Freezer storage
and shipping required

How to Use SKC Preloaded Coated Filters
1. Select one coated lter casse e for calibrating the ow rate. A red plug
secures the inlet, which is clearly marked “inlet,” and a blue plug secures the
outlet. Set up the sampling train for calibration with the representative lter
casse e in line. For “closed-face” sampling, remove the plugs and connect the
casse e to the sampling train. For “open-face” sampling, remove the outlet
plug and the casse e inlet section then connect the casse e to the sampling
train. For details on se ing up a sampling train, refer to the SKC Sample Setup
Guide “Sampling Train - Filters and Cyclones” (SKC Publication 1166).
2. Calibrate the pump to the desired ow rate using a lm owmeter or
calibrated precision rotameter. For details on calibrating a pump, refer to the
SKC Sample Setup Guide “Calibrating a Pump Using a Film Flowmeter” (SKC
Publication 1163).
3. Replace the casse e used for calibration with a fresh coated lter casse e
for sample collection. A ach the casse e to a workers collar, as close to the
breathing zone as possible, by using a lter casse e holder (SKC Cat. No.
225-1). Sample for the speci ed time interval and record the time.
4. Remove the lter casse e at the end of the speci ed sampling period and
replace both end plugs (and the inlet if necessary). Recheck the ow rate using
the same casse e and owmeter used for calibration in Step 2 to ensure that
the ow rate has not changed by more than 5%.
5. Store samples at -4 F (-20 C). Appropriately package samples, blanks, and
all pertinent data to send to a lab for analysis. Expedite shipping of samples
to laboratory. Friday shipments are not recommended.
